svalavuo преди 6 дни
родител
ревизия
fbaf61b14f
променени са 1 файла, в които са добавени 4 реда и са изтрити 2 реда
  1. 4 2
      admin/login.php

+ 4 - 2
admin/login.php

@@ -4,13 +4,15 @@ require_once '../includes/database.php';
 require_once '../includes/auth.php';
 require_once '../includes/auth.php';
 
 
 // Start session for language preference
 // Start session for language preference
-session_start();
+if (session_status() === PHP_SESSION_NONE) {
+    session_start();
+}
 
 
 // Initialize translation system
 // Initialize translation system
 try {
 try {
     $translation = Translation::getInstance();
     $translation = Translation::getInstance();
 } catch (Exception $e) {
 } catch (Exception $e) {
-    // Fallback to basic translations if LDAP fails
+    // Fallback to basic translations if translation system fails
     $translation = null;
     $translation = null;
 }
 }